When a user attempts to leave, the Discord client sends an API request to the central platform servers. Because the jail server's automated bots are actively flooding the system with massive role and channel updates, the server instantly hits Discord’s global API rate-limits. The platform prioritizes processing or throttling the internal flood, causing external user requests—like trying to exit the guild—to be dropped or completely ignored by the congested gateway.
